Structural repair services focus on restoring the stability and integrity of a building’s framework. Over time, homes and commercial properties can develop issues such as cracked or sagging foundations, compromised load-bearing walls, or damaged beams. These problems often result from settling, moisture intrusion, or other structural stresses. Engaging experienced contractors to assess and repair these issues can help prevent further damage, ensure safety, and maintain the property’s value. Proper structural repair involves identifying the root cause of the problem and implementing solutions that reinforce the building’s framework effectively.
Many common issues that lead to structural repair needs include foundation cracks, uneven flooring, or walls that bow or lean. These signs can indicate deeper problems within the building’s foundation or support system. If left unaddressed, structural issues can worsen over time, leading to costly repairs or even safety hazards. The overview below groups typical Structural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Greenbrier,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or structural fixes, such as crack repairs or small foundation patches,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Projects - larger repairs like partial foundation stabilization or wall reinforcement often c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ing noticeable issues before they worsen.
Major Repairs - extensive structural repairs, including significant foundation underpinning or large wall replacements, can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ving complex or longstanding issues.
Full Replacement - complete foundation or structural component replacements may exceed $15,000, with costs varying based on size and scope.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on the specific needs of each project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ating local contractors. Homeowners should request detailed descriptions of the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in the repair process. Having this information in writing helps to prevent misunderstandings and provides a basis for comparing different service providers. It also allows homeowners to ask informed questions and ensure that the proposed solutions align with their needs and priorities.
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able structural repair contractor. Homeowners should ask for references from past clients who had similar work done, and follow up to learn about their experiences. Good communication throughout the process-prompt responses to questions, transparency about procedures, and clarity about timelines-can significantly impact satisfaction with the project.
